Craig MacTavish

Wikimedia Commons

Before he became the Vice President of Hockey Operations for the Edmonton Oilers, Craig MacTavish served a year in prison for vehicular homicide. On Jan. 25, 1984, the hockey player killed a woman while driving under the influence of alcohol. The conviction didn’t seem to affect his career though, as MacTavish signed with the Oilers immediately after his release.
